Call Of The Wild Slot Theme, Stakes, Pays & Symbols

Call Of The Wild Slot Paytable
Call of the Wild slot paytable

If you haven’t been paying full attention to the online slots industry recently, then Call of the Wild might not look instantly familiar to you. For those who play far too many slots, however, I suspect you will already be aware of games such as the fantastic Wolf Legend Megaways by now! That game took plenty of inspiration from the legendary Buffalo Gold series of slot machines, so I guess you can’t really criticise Inspired too much for creating their own take on a theme that has already been copied to death!

Okay, so we’re not going to be firing shots at the developers for their hint of plagiarism on this occasion, but I certainly will be criticising them if their paytable doesn’t hold up! Starting from the top, the wild shares its 15x stake payout for six-of-a-kind with the highest-paying regular symbol, the wolf. The bald eagle and leopard are a distant second with their payout of 8x your bet for a full payline, whilst the bear and horse make the third and final high-paying pairing with a return of 5x your stake for all six symbols. As for the lower values, they are represented by four royal symbols. These are the J, Q, K, and Ace, all of which will pay 4x bet for a six of a kind hit.

The betting range is, quite frankly, a little bit insane – at least in the free-play mode. There’s no issue with the minimum bet of €0.20 per round, but at the opposite end of the spectrum, we have a maximum wager of €400.00 per spin! I suspect that this will be a lot lower when playing for real money at some, if not all, online casinos.


Base Game & Modifiers

Call Of The Wild Slot Base Game
Call of the Wild slot base game

The basic gameplay in Call of the Wild takes place on a huge reel set sporting six reels of four rows each. Most games that utilise a playfield of this size will use payways rather than paylines, so the 25 fixed paylines offered here make the slot somewhat unique. It also means that you are likely to hit lots of near misses during play, as so many of the potential paths from left to right are not connected for wins.


Mystery Symbol Modifier

Call of the Wild includes one solitary modifier, and if I’m honest, I didn’t find this to be especially exciting despite its potential to create a reasonably sized win. The mystery symbol modifier can trigger whilst any base game spin is in play, adding a random number of mystery symbols to the reels. Unfortunately, the paytable does not indicate if there are minimum/maximum numbers of mystery symbols that the feature can deliver.

When the reels stop spinning, all of the mystery symbols which are now visible will transform into one symbol chosen at random from the paytable. This could be the wild symbol, it could be a high-paying symbol, or it could just be a royal. In my experience, the more mystery symbols are added, the less valuable they tend to be, which certainly didn’t boost my opinion of the feature.


Call Of The Wild Slot Bonus Features

Call Of The Wild Slot Bonus Round
Call of the Wild slot bonus round

Landing six or more wild symbols during the base game will trigger the Wild Win & Spin feature. You can either catch six wilds as part of a regular spin, or you can also trigger the feature as a result of the mystery symbol modifier if it chooses to transform symbols into wilds.


Wild Win & Spin Feature

Immediately after the Wild Win & Spin feature activates, all the triggering wild symbols will become sticky and lock into their current positions. Your remaining spin counter is set to three, and the reels will begin to spin automatically.

You must land at least one additional wild symbol on each spin; otherwise, one life will be lost, and your remaining spin counter will be reduced. If you do manage to score an additional wild, your remaining spin counter is reset to three.

This process will repeat indefinitely until you either (a) run out of lives or (b) fill the entire reel set with wilds. The game will automatically pay you 375x your bet in the latter case.

If the screen is not filled with wild symbols at the end of the Wild Win & Spin feature, the game will award you one final free spin with all wild symbols locked in place. This final spin is an excellent opportunity to land a decent win, although if you consider that the game only pays 375x for a full screen of wilds, the potential of this final spin is obviously much less.

Call Of The Wild Slot Review Final Thoughts

Call of the Wild boasts well-drawn graphics and better-than-average presentation, but the winnings available in the game let it down. With a jackpot of just 375x your bet in the bonus round and no way to get anywhere close to that during the base game, you almost have to question where all the RTP has gone in this one! This slot might appeal to those who enjoy lower volatility slots, but everybody else should look elsewhere.
